What Are the Key Features of the Best Choice Treadmill?

The key features of the best choice treadmill include:

  • Durability: A high-quality treadmill should be built to withstand regular use, featuring a sturdy frame and reliable components that can handle varying weights and workout intensities.
  • Motor Power: The treadmill’s motor power, typically measured in horsepower (HP), is crucial for ensuring smooth operation, particularly during high-intensity workouts, allowing users to run at different speeds without lag.
  • Incline Options: The best treadmills offer adjustable incline settings, enabling users to simulate uphill running, which helps enhance calorie burn and strengthen different muscle groups.
  • Workout Programs: A variety of pre-set workout programs can provide users with structured routines that cater to different fitness levels and goals, enhancing workout variety and motivation.
  • Foldability: Many top treadmills feature a foldable design, making them easier to store in smaller spaces, which is especially beneficial for home gym settings.
  • Heart Rate Monitoring: Integrated heart rate monitors, either through built-in sensors or chest straps, allow users to track their heart rate in real-time, which is essential for optimizing workouts and ensuring safety.
  • Running Surface: A spacious running surface with adequate cushioning can enhance comfort and reduce impact on joints, making workouts more enjoyable and less stressful on the body.
  • Connectivity Features: Modern treadmills may include Bluetooth connectivity, allowing users to sync their fitness apps, listen to music, or even watch videos while exercising, which can significantly enhance the workout experience.

How Can You Ensure the Best Choice Treadmill Lasts Longer?

To ensure that the best choice treadmill lasts longer, consider the following practices:

  • Regular Maintenance: Frequent cleaning and lubrication of the treadmill components are essential for its longevity. Dust and debris can accumulate, affecting the motor and belt performance, so wiping down the surfaces and lubricating the belt according to the manufacturer’s recommendations can help prevent wear and tear.
  • Proper Usage: Adhering to the weight limit and intended use of the treadmill can significantly extend its lifespan. Overloading the machine can strain the motor and other components, leading to premature breakdowns; hence, following the user guidelines ensures optimal operation.
  • Use a Mat: Placing a mat underneath the treadmill can protect the floor and reduce vibrations. This not only helps in stabilizing the machine but also minimizes the impact on its components, which can prolong its life and enhance performance.
  • Environment Control: Keeping the treadmill in a climate-controlled environment helps in maintaining its functionality. Excessive humidity or temperature fluctuations can damage electrical components, so it’s best to keep the treadmill in a dry, cool area.
  • Periodic Inspection: Regularly checking for loose bolts or worn-out parts can prevent small issues from becoming major problems. Performing these inspections allows users to address issues proactively and maintain the treadmill in good working condition.
  • Following Manufacturer Guidelines: Adhering to the manufacturer’s instructions for assembly, usage, and maintenance is crucial. These guidelines are designed to maximize the lifespan and performance of the treadmill, so following them ensures that you are using it as intended.
